I can't install the Blender Lite into Blender no matter how, and I followed the instructions. Is my version updated or not?

@ZackArmstrong, Please specify what versions your are using of both Blender and Lite add-on. Latest revision of Lite 3.1.4 is compatible/optimized with Blender 2.90 according to the change log.

@ZackArmstrong I think I remember that in order to install the add on, you must first extract the file that you get from downloading. Do not attempt to install it from the .zip file you get, as it will not work. Next, go into Blender preferences, go into addons, press install, and locate the unzipped folder. Inside will be another .zip folder. That is the one you need to install. Select it and press Install. I apologise if I am just repeating what you already know and the problem is not the process I am describing, or am relaying the instructions in an incorrect or unclear way. I hope this helps, though.

Edit: If this doesn’t work, try installing a newer version of Blender, as Sealund said. If you’re using a version that is not 2.90, you may encounter some bugs.

I've used this website and it's free add-on in the past and am familiar with it, but I've ran into a problem when I wanted to use it earlier:
exporting a model from the website gives me a file with the extension .mbx but the add-on looks for the .zmbx extension and renaming it doesn't fix it (just gives an error, probably because the file corrupts from changing the extension)

I even downloaded the newest version of the add-on
is there a fix for this or is the entire system fucked right now?

Avatar of Scrubs
Administrator

I bet that you are using Safari. Make sure that in your preferences you do not allow Safari to automatically unzip archive files. zmbx is the zipped version mbx files.
